We are being asked to do things you wouldn\u2019t ask anybody. I don\u2019t get someone else to pay for my hydro; why are we being asked to pay for yours?<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e\u2019re not interested in getting into a fight with anybody. We have been there for 40 years and we have had a successful relationship with the Town of Aurora for over 40 years. We save the Town of Aurora $500,000 every year just in labour costs alone. That is a lot of money. I don\u2019t know what other charitable organization in our Town does that. To suddenly toss this history, this tradition, this successful relationship that we have always had out the window because of some notion that we want more, or we have to do things better, without any real consideration of what the repercussions are going to be, seems just not right.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>But, he added, if the Town of Aurora wants to \u201cplay the game\u201d they are ready to step it up. After 40 years, however, their question is why.<br \/>\n\u201cWe provide life skills, we bring new people in to learn about self-reliance, learn about courage, the importance of working and collaborative effort,\u201d he continued. \u201cThey know about work ethic, about doing things they didn\u2019t think they could. These aren\u2019t just theatrical skills. These are things that will make you successful everywhere you go.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If we don\u2019t have culture and we don\u2019t have art, we have nothing. We are another suburb. We have the chance with a proper lease and fair lease to do something that is going to last forever and last way past all of us and we have a choice. Either we do something that is going to be a blight on our history, or we do something that is going to be a highlight, a turning point in our road to the greatness that our town is destined to have.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Little information was offered at last week\u2019s meeting on where things stand right now, but Mayor Geoff Dawe said Aurora CAO Doug Nadorozny has marked this as a \u201cvery high priority\u201d item with meetings set up this week to continue the discussions.<\/p>\n<p>Nevertheless, other members of Theatre Aurora stepped forward to provide words of support, including long-time actor, producer and director Jo-anne Spitzer and Board member Joey Ferguson. Mr. Ferguson, for instance, told Councillors he became involved with the theatre as a youth member, growing not only to become a Board member, but an active member with several directorial and design productions notched onto his belt.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cTheatre Aurora is an important part of my life. For me, it is more than just a theatre; we are a community, a family, a group of individuals across all ages who come together with one common goal: to entertain,\u201d he said. \u201cMy involvement with Theatre Aurora has done much for where I am today. It prompted me both to go into media production and most recently teaching, where I will be starting my career come September.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At this time, Members of Town Staff that Theatre Aurora\u2019s Board of Directors have been negotiating the lease [with] have put us in an uncomfortable position. We feel that they have been pushing terms that are unfair and do not represent the long relationship that we have had with the Town, nor follow the Town of Aurora\u2019s Cultural mandate.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cI do ask as our representatives, both as citizens and as a charitable non-profit community cultural organization, that on our behalf you ask why this relationship has been threatened for reasons we don\u2019t know about and why at least, in my personal opinion and personal feelings, that culture in Aurora [feels] like it is under attack once again.\u201d<\/p>\n<a
